Some of the biggest names in Canadian music are in Edmonton for the Fire Aid concert at Commonwealth Stadium on Wednesday, June 29 to help Fort McMurray evacuees.

Fire Aid released the set list Tuesday morning. Doors will open at 4 p.m., with Dustin Bentall getting the concert started at 4:45 p.m. Corb Lund will take the stage at 8 p.m., Blue Rodeo will be on at 9:05 p.m., and Nickelback will close out the event at 10:05 p.m.

“The great majority of artists reached out to us once the word got out that there was an event happening,” VP of Live Nation Canada Harvey Cohen said. “People literally started lining up asking to be involved.”

Proceeds from the concert will go directly to United Way for the rebuild in Fort McMurray.

Tickets to the concert are still available, and organizers said that they are hoping to sell another 5,000 tickets tomorrow.

The Fire Aid concert will also be livestreamed to a football field in Fort McMurray where people will be able to watch the show.
